Alliance Warfare and Negotiation in Ogame

Ogame isn’t solely about resource gathering and developing here your empire; a significant portion of the gameplay revolves around federation warfare and complex negotiation. Successfully navigating these aspects is often the key to long-term survival and dominance on a universe. Alliances provide a vital layer of protection against aggressive neighbors and offer opportunities for coordinated attacks, material sharing, and mutual support. However, maintaining a strong alliance demands active communication, strategic planning, and the ability to resolve internal conflicts. Effective diplomacy with rival alliances is equally crucial; forging temporary truces, engaging in strategic alliances of convenience, and understanding the motivations of your opponents can often be more valuable than brute force. Mastering the art of federation management and politics will elevate your Ogame experience from mere conquest to a dynamic and engaging struggle for galactic influence. The ever-shifting landscape of alliances and rivalries makes each universe a unique and unpredictable battlefield.

Perfecting Ogame: Vessel Assembly and Combat Approaches

Ogame's dynamic gameplay revolves significantly around vessel composition and tactical combat. Building a powerful fleet requires a deep understanding of existing technologies and resource management. Simply amassing the most powerful ships isn't enough; successful combat often demands thoughtful ship specialization. Consider utilizing a mix of offensive ships, shielding cruisers, and support vessels to counter various opponent formations. Arrangement is crucial; safeguarding your weaker craft while targeting key enemy targets can be the difference between triumph and defeat. Experimenting with different craft combinations and battle orders is essential to find your signature Ogame approach.
